    Agreed with everyone above. I had some poker comps for a free breakfast buffet. Currently the Excalibur Buffet is closed. The food at Excalibur breakfast and Luxor Breakfast is nearly identical. If your hungry, want a quick get me full type breakfast I think its great. If you want to taste different, 'exotic' type food. This isn't the place.

    Would I pay full price? for 16.99. Its okay. I think if it was at 10 or 12 I think its a good deal.
